- Conduct daily site quality work inspection to ensure compliance with the project’s specifications, quality standards and contractual requirements.
- Monitor project teams’ adherence to the approved work methodologies.
- Monitor workmanship to prevent defects and substandard work.
- Ensure that all materials used meet the approved specifications and quality standards.
- Report non-conformances to project team and ensure project team are following up on corrective actions.
- Prepare and maintain quality control inspection reports, including photographic evidence and recommendations for remedial actions.
- Assist in reviewing and approving method statements, inspection test plans (ITPs) and quality control procedures.
- Participate in project meetings, providing insights on quality issues, risks and mitigation measures.
- Ensure that safety and environmental regulations related to quality control are adhered to at all times.
- Support internal and external audits by providing necessary quality records, reports, and documentation.
Requirements:
- Possess Degree in Civil Engineering/Building Technology/Construction Management or its equivalent.
- Minimum 6 – 8 years’ working experience preferably from a building and construction industry in a similar position.
- Conversant in bilingual languages, namely English and Bahasa Malaysia.
- Have strong leadership, interpersonal and communication skills with strong inclination towards quality management practices.
- Knowledgeable in ISO 9001, ISO 45001 and ISO 14001 Standard and provide unlimited support for the implementation and on-going maintenance for the Company’s Quality, Environmental, Safety & Health Management System (QESHMS).
